Output efbd1d054096d4fcd5adedc355a22e86be8e4a147fd38de6eaeef2d95eae7f6d:0

value
3085600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c002478070525efc09a9a8fb763ec73c3daff8fd OP_EQUAL
address
3KCGPk71dZHzWmv3cDBhctX4FUaHRASuFZ
transaction
efbd1d054096d4fcd5adedc355a22e86be8e4a147fd38de6eaeef2d95eae7f6d